会员
周边
众包
新闻
博问
闪存
赞助商
Chat2DB
所有博客
当前博客
我的博客
我的园子
账号设置
简洁模式
...
退出登录
注册
登录
上海邻居网
上海小区
上海活动
上海换物
邻居好友
临渊羡鱼,不如退而结网
博客园
首页
新随笔
联系
管理
订阅
2010年10月22日
C#中抽象类和接口的区别
摘要: 大家都容易把这两者搞混,我也一样,在听李建忠老师的设计模式时,他也老把抽象类说成接口,弄的我就更糊涂了,所以找了些网上的资料. 一、抽象类: 抽象类是特殊的类,只是不能被实例化;除此以外,具有类的其他特性;重要的是抽象类可以包括抽象方法,这是普通类所不能的。抽象方法只能声明于抽象类中,且不包含任何实现,派生类必须覆盖它们。另外,抽象类可以派生自一个抽象类,可以覆盖基类的抽象方法也可以不覆盖,如果不...
阅读全文
posted @ 2010-10-22 10:56 Jayan
阅读(338)
评论(0)
推荐(0)
编辑
公告